Twitter4j getRelatedResults()停止工作API v1.1

时间:2013-08-09 15:19:02

标签: java api twitter migration twitter4j

最近Twitter从API v1更改为v1.1。我正在使用twitter4j来获取与指定推文相关的回复和提及。用于执行此类操作的方法称为getRelatedResults(id),但它不再有效。

我一直在:

The Twitter REST API v1 is no longer active. Please migrate to API v1.1. 
https://dev.twitter.com/docs/api/1.1/overview.

但我仍然没有在API v1.1中找到一个等效的方法。

有什么建议吗?

我发现了什么:

以下代码不会替换相关结果,请将其作为获得回复的好方法:

您可以使用InReplyToStatusId

使用Status.getInReplyToStatusId()字段值

使用API​​ v1.1以递归方式使用下面的代码来获取推文的所有回复或对话:

Status status = twitterAPI.showStatus(status.getInReplyToStatusId());
System.out.println(status.getText());

0 个答案:

没有答案